**Logistics Provider Change — Managers Only**

Effective next quarter, Veltrix Freight replaces Cordano Haulage as primary carrier for the Brennswick and Oleva depots. Contract terms improve per-pallet rates by roughly 9% and shorten settlement cycles to 30 days. Finance should update accrual schedules and close out remaining Cordano invoices by month-end. Transition costs are capped and booked under Q3 operations. Do not circulate beyond this group. Further context on strategic rationale follows below.

board note of bawep-tajef: Queniusek Systems plans to raise the Quenvan list price by 53.1 percent in March. The pricing group signed off on a budget of $176.4 million for Project Drueth. The renewal with Casionix Partners closes at $142.5 million a year, 8.3 percent below the last contract. Project Fraax slips by six weeks because of the tooling delay.

Canary gating, Driftline deploys: a canary holds at 5% for 20 minutes. Promotion is blocked if error rate exceeds 0.5% or p99 latency rises 15% over baseline. Support cannot override gates; only the Driftline release captain can. If a customer reports breakage during a canary window, note the build hash in the ticket. Full gating thresholds and escalation steps are documented on the internal page below.

operations page: https://jenkins.zemvarcloud.local/job/merge_requests/repo/build/73930b4b30f0a8ed

TICKET: Request tracing gaps across Ferrowind microservices. Spans from the checkout path drop between the Laskin gateway and the pricing tier, so roughly 12% of traces arrive headless in Spyglass. We verified header propagation in the gateway but the pricing sidecar strips baggage on retries. Tomas has a patch queued; Ilka is adding a regression probe to staging. Please review before the weekly sync. The earliest affected deployment carries the build token shown below.

build token for kafof-hahif: htk6_462aaf

**Action item: Add alerting for stale rate snapshots in ParityScope.**

During the incident, our rate-parity checker compared week-old Bramblewood Hotels rates against live competitor prices, generating false parity violations for hours. New team members should understand that snapshot freshness is not currently monitored. We will add a staleness alert with a two-hour threshold. The design notes and rollout plan are documented on the internal page.

dashboard of kafof-tahaf = https://confluence.tolvaqsys.internal/projects/browse/display/a1250987